"The Book of Life" is a movie which focusing on the life of the people in the Mexican city called San Angel, whereby there's a life of three best friend, Manolo (Diego Luna), Maria (ZoëSaldana) and Joaquin (Channing Tatum). The three of them have getting to know each other since their childhood, and although their lives have taken different paths -- Maria was sent to Europe, Joaquin joined the military, and Manolo studied to become a bullfighter -- one thing remains the same: Manolo and Joaquin both want to marry Maria. Little does the trio know that battling husband-and-wife deities have made a high-stakes wager on the love triangle's outcome.And there's also the part whereby Manolo has to "die" for some sort of moment before he was returned back to become human because of the curse made by the villain character.
